Report: Yorkshire Vikings v Leicestershire Foxes, Vitality Blast
Yorkshire lost their second successive Vitality Blast match, failing to chase 167 against Leicestershire. The Vikings bowled the Foxes out for 166 in 19.5 overs, with Jafer Chohan, Dan Moriarty and Matthew Revis all claiming two wickets apiece. Unfortunately, they then slipped to a 20-run loss, finishing on 146-9.
